Proud Of The Princeton 7 v 7 Champions Seven of our very own Metro 2013s competed in the Princeton University Tiger Challenge 7 v 7. The players were put in the toughest bracket and had an extremely successful day. They beat highly competitive teams, such as Ultimate, Tri-State, Thunder Lax and South Jersey Select. Their only loss of the day was to Ridgewood; they lost 7-6. This phenomenal record advanced these girls to the playoffs where they played and beat PA Express and Ultimate 2012. These two victories advanced the girls to the championship game, where they were not discouraged to compete against Ridgewood for the second time of the day. The outcome of this day was different, and these 2013 girls came up with the victory to gain the title of tournament champions! We are so very proud of these 7, Hayley Shaffer, Anna Vitton, Virginia Annaheim, Lauren Oberlander, Elizabeth Cusick, Heidi Annaheim, Stephanie Carr and Hannah Reader for their outstanding play at the Princeton Tournament! We are also very proud of all the other Metro girls who attended this tournament and continue to make lacrosse priority in the off season! Great work ladies! |

Fall Ball in Full Effect This year has been the best received year of Fall Ball Ever!! We had the most participants in the history of the program enabling us to field 12 full teams. We had girls from over 20 different high schools and up to 30 girls at the middle school level. We had multiple returning seniors who came to hone their skills while providing free coaching and demonstrating their leaderships ability to the underclassman. This innovative program provided a low key, no pressure opportunity to practice skills and enhance the love of lacrosse! |
